@Jenruffin wrote:
Does anyone else have the problem of the Fitbit blaze counting steps while your laying in bed? All I have to do is swing my arm back and forth and the count goes up.
@Jenruffin Welcome.. Yes, Fitbit is a movement detector and for my last nights 9 hours elapsed sleep time which included a bathroom break and fix a computer problem for my night owl musician son, there were only 274 steps movement. That is a typical nights movement unless I have extra blankets and I get too hot, the night before was only 67 steps because I only used one blanket and only one bathroom visit.
I also find it interesting with the way resting heart rate varies with sleeping temperature..
